CAMP4 (CAMP) stock outlook | earnings expectations and sector performance remain in focus. CAMP4 Therapeutics Corporation (CAMP) closed at $4.51, gaining 2.50% in the latest session. The stock is testing a resistance zone near $4.74 after bouncing from support at $4.28. Volume patterns suggest renewed buying interest, though the overall trend remains within a defined trading range.
